Uniquely also offering a plot with outline planning permission to build two detached 4-bed homes - subject to full planning application.
Featured in Dwell magazine, this home is a fantastic collaboration between the current owners and Ratliff Landells, a dynamic local architect. To quote them - 'Working closely with the client, a brief emerged that sought to increase the capacity of the existing cottage in an honest and contemporary way, while maintaining the integrity and street frontage of the original building. The simple design of the original cottage was, therefore, the catalyst for the striking roof profile and near-symmetrical layout of the proposed extension. Key points for the client were maximum sunlight, increased capacity, provision for services, robust materials, and energy conservation for both the existing and new structures.'
Walking into the property the rooms consist of:
Entrance hall.
Front left - music room/office (previously a playroom) with sightline through to the open plan extension to the rear (fireplace could be reinstated if desired).
Front right - snug lounge with open fire.
To the rear - full-width kitchen/diner/lounge, a stunning open-plan space bathed with light, where exposed traditional brick contrasts with modern block and a vaulted double-height space connects the old and new buildings.
A more recent downstairs addition of a utilities and storage area (with sink, fitted cupboards and access to both rear garden and driveway), add a generous and useful space for supplies and storage, away from the clean, open-plan living.
Beyond the utility sits a modern WC with large walk-in shower and heated towel rail.
From within the open-plan space, stairs alight to the first floor, where two double bedrooms sit within the original cottage.
A bridge set within the double-height area, leads to two new, larger bedrooms plus the family bathroom to the rear, all overlooking the garden.
The expansive and secluded rear garden, with established trees and hedges around the perimeter, has a large, decked area and is mainly laid to lawn. Backing onto farmers’ fields.
There is gated side-access to the private-lane side of the property, with ample hidden storage space for bike, bin and general garden items, plus a large 6 x 16ft shed.
To the other side of the property, the driveway provides off-street parking for two vehicles, with direct access to the utility.
The rear plot can comfortably hold two detached dwellings, easily accessed via the private lane. All three homes would retain good gardens.
Gas central heating throughout the property, including underfloor heating throughout the extension and a separate backup electric water heater and shower in the utility space.
The three pitches of the roof were specifically designed to be solar panel ready.
For thermal efficiency, the previous solid block cottage is wrapped in high performance insulation plus insulated render. All modern extension walls are all double-layer block with thick insulation.
The front of house has had high-performance triple-glazed, timber windows installed. All glazing to the rear is double-glazed aluminium framed.
The rear and side extensions consist of fair-faced blocks and both chimney stacks for the original cottage remain accessible.
